Updated Design Revealed for 642-Meter Tower in Shenzhen

29 January 2019 | Shenzhen, China

bKL Architecture has unveiled its proposed design for a new, 642-meter tower located in Shenzhen, China. The 128-story tower is intended to mark the gateway to the eastern expansion of the emerging region.

The full development will include commercial, civic, office, hotel, and residential program. The form of the tower transforms in response to the building program, giving the structure its unique profile and evoking the relationship between people and their environment.

As the building rises, the form gently steps back to offer areas of rainwater capture along the full façade of the building. The projected rainwater capture will replace the building’s annual estimated water usage.

The scheme pictured is an update from a previous design for the site.
